What Is the Net Price by Family Income at Illinois Central College? (2022-23)

The net price at Illinois Central College ranges from $8,666 for the lowest-income families upward. Understanding these brackets helps with financial planning.

$0 - $30,000

$8,666

$30,001 - $48,000

$9,666

$48,001 - $75,000

$12,329

$75,001 - $110,000

$15,827

Over $110,000

$16,792

What Financial Aid Is Available at Illinois Central College? (2022-23)

Financial aid at Illinois Central College reaches 51% of first-time students through grants and scholarships. Explore additional aid options below.

Students Receiving Any Financial Aid

514 of 850 students

60%

Grants & Scholarships

Recipients

432 (51%)

Average Award

$5,522

Federal Pell Grants

Recipients

274 (32%)

Average Award

$4,984

Aid by Source

State & Local Grants

241 recipients (28%)

$1,969 avg

Institutional Grants

208 recipients (24%)

$2,426 avg
